32oz Water Soluble Guano Concentrate for Dense Flowering
Getting plants to push dense, abundant flowering takes more than a general-purpose feed once they hit the bloom stage. Tappin' Roots Solid Bloom is a high-phosphorus, water soluble formula derived from natural sources.

Frequently Asked Questions
- What is Tappin' Roots Solid Bloom made from?
- It's derived from natural sources, including concentrated seabird guano, bat guano, and essential minerals. Those ingredients form a wide spectrum of targeted nutrients aimed at the flowering stage.
- What growth stage is this formula built for?
- It's tailored to develop dense, abundant flowering and fruit yields. That makes it best suited to the bloom and fruiting stage rather than early vegetative growth.
- Is this product water soluble?
- Yes, it's formulated as a water soluble concentrate. That solubility lets it be mixed into a standard watering or feeding routine.
